Output 665e89e6c767cc935f341a7796f2c5e26e30e760e630b0181dba59f0d4551c29:0

value
16711316
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e52bc50b96590f90c7d2a59cb78bf69e4891ebcb OP_EQUALVERIFY OP_CHECKSIG
address
1MtkB6uSssbtjtMMktcpT8dVo1LkM6Sn44
transaction
665e89e6c767cc935f341a7796f2c5e26e30e760e630b0181dba59f0d4551c29
confirmations
529961
spent
true